(7-Methoxy-2-oxo-2H-chromen-4-yl)acetic acid

MCA is a coumarin derivative. MCA quantitates platelet-activating factor by high-performance liquid chromatography with fluorescent detection. MCA can modify FRET peptide substrates for analyzing protease activities[1][2].

  • CAS Number: 62935-72-2
  • MF: C12H10O5
  • MW: 234.205
  • Catalog: Others
  • Density: 1.4±0.1 g/cm3
  • Boiling Point: 472.9±45.0 °C at 760 mmHg
  • Melting Point: 193 °C (dec.)(lit.)
  • Flash Point: 189.2±22.2 °C

DSPE-succinic acid

DSPE-succinic acid is a phophalipid capped with a carboxylic acid moiety. The carboxylic acid moiety is reactive with amine to from a stable amide linkage. DSPE-succinic acid can be used to prepare nanoparticles or liposomes for drug nanocarrier to deliver therapeutics[1].

  • CAS Number: 248253-94-3
  • MF: C45H86NO11P
  • MW: 848.14
  • Catalog: Others
  • Density: N/A
  • Boiling Point: N/A
  • Melting Point: N/A
  • Flash Point: N/A

Imidacloprid-urea

Imidacloprid-urea is a metabolite of Imidacloprid. Imidacloprid is an effective and widely used neonicotinoid pesticide to control pests of cereals, vegetables, tea and cotton. Imidacloprid-urea can occupy or block adsorption sites of imidacloprid on soil, potentially affecting the fate, transport, and bioavailability of imidacloprid in the environment[1].

  • CAS Number: 120868-66-8
  • MF: C9H10ClN3O
  • MW: 211.64800
  • Catalog: Others
  • Density: 1.359g/cm3
  • Boiling Point: 478.388ºC at 760 mmHg
  • Melting Point: N/A
  • Flash Point: 243.12ºC

C24:1-Ceramide

C24:1-Ceramide is one of the most abundant naturally occurring ceramide. Ceramides regulates many diverse biological activities, such as cell apoptosis, cell differentiation, proliferation of smooth muscle cells, and inhibition of the mitochondrial respiratory chain[1][2][3].

  • CAS Number: 54164-50-0
  • MF: C42H81NO3
  • MW: 648.097
  • Catalog: Apoptosis
  • Density: 0.9±0.1 g/cm3
  • Boiling Point: 749.6±60.0 °C at 760 mmHg
  • Melting Point: N/A
  • Flash Point: 407.1±32.9 °C
